5 Tips to Grow & Maintain Your Business in this Tough EconomyThere's no doubt that our tough economy is preventing people from
buying discretionary products and services. Many are afraid that they won't have jobs at the end of the month, so they
are reluctant to spend money. And they are starting to second guess purchases they would have originally made without a second
thought. So, as business owners we need to set ourselves apart
and offer top quality, second to none services and products. Here are 5 tips to grow and maintain your business in this tough
economy. 1. Setting and maintaining realistic goals that can
be accomplished long-term, will keep you focused and on track. 2.
Grow wisely without surplus or waste. Carefully think through your buying power. Do you really need that new laser copier
or will the ink jet on your desk suffice for now? Spend your business income wisely as there is no guarantee that the money
will come in tomorrow. So, manage your funds wisely, frugally and carefully. 3. Understand your market and how you belong in it. By knowing who your target market is, you will be able to promote
your business correctly and more efficiently. 4. Be courteous.
Treat your customer like they are your only customer. Go that extra mile to ensure that your customer is satisfied with your
product and/or service. 5. Under promise & over deliver.
When your customer feels that they are getting the best value for their hard-earned dollar, you have earned their trust and
they will be repeat customers.
